Example 1
Referring to fig. 1-3, the present invention provides a technical solution: a pair of suture forceps comprises a suture forceps main body 2, one end of the suture forceps main body 2 is connected with a forceps head 1 through a bolt, one end of the forceps head 1 is connected with a forceps rod 3 through a bolt, the outer side of the forceps rod 3 is connected with a rotating wheel 4 through a clamping, one end of the forceps rod 3, which is far away from the forceps head 1, is connected with a handle 5 through a bolt, the bottom of the handle 5 is connected with a handle 7 through a bolt, the suture forceps main body 2 further comprises an adjusting device, the adjusting device is arranged at the bottom of the suture forceps main body 2 and comprises a fixed pipe 10, a movable groove 9 is formed in the surface of the fixed pipe 10, the inner side of the movable groove 9 is connected with a connecting block 12 through a clamping, a connecting nut 13 is welded at the bottom of the connecting block 12, the inner side of the connecting nut 13 is connected with a lead screw 11, the opening size of the binding clip 1 can be adjusted by a user according to actual conditions.
In this embodiment, it is preferable that the connecting block 12 is fitted to the movable groove 9, and the top of the connecting block 12 is connected to the handle 7, so that the position of the handle 7 can be easily adjusted by connecting the connecting block 12 to the handle 7.
In this embodiment, preferably, the connecting nut 13 is adapted to the screw rod 11, and the knob 8 is welded to one end of the screw rod 11 penetrating through the fixing tube 10, so that the connecting nut 13 moves along the screw rod 11 by rotating the screw rod 11 through the arrangement of the screw rod 11 and the connecting nut 13.
In this embodiment, preferably, one end of the fixed tube 10 is connected to the bottom of the handle 5, and the movable groove 9 is located on the top surface of the fixed tube 10, so that the connecting block 12 can move along the movable groove 9 conveniently by providing the movable groove 9.

The utility model discloses a theory of operation and use flow: after a user moves the suturing forceps main body 2 to a proper position, the opening of the forceps head 1 is adjusted to a proper size by rotating the knob 8, then a suturing needle is placed on the inner side of the forceps head 1, the knob 8 is turned reversely, so that the forceps head 1 extrudes and fixes the suturing needle, and then the user grasps the handle 5 and the handle 7 to suture a wound of a patient;
